I like them. I have them on both my "road" bikes, but they are both cyclocross. About them being in the way, I routinely seem them mounted where I've always been told was the incorrect position. OP's is like this also. I've always been told they should be mounted nearly vertical. I changed mine to this configuration and I like them mounted this way more. As far as braking is concerned, I only use them for slow speeds. Going down a steep decent, I'm always in the drops. Much better control and braking. Never had issues with canti's either. It's all in the adjustment and quality of pads.
